Manchester United face a long wait between Premier League fixtures, with their next domestic assignment the small matter of a Manchester derby.

The trip to the Etihad on Sunday, October 2 will be their first league game in four weeks. That hiatus is down to the fact that two matches, against Crystal Palace and Leeds, were pushed back following the death of the Queen as well as an international break pencilled in for later this month.

When the game does eventually come around United will at least have had the chance to maintain their match sharpness with Europa League games and plenty of players featuring in internationals.

Those meetings with Real Sociedad and Sheriff Tiraspol, though, are unlikely to be anywhere near the levels of intensity for a game against Pep Guardiola's men.
